Welcome to episode twelve of our success story series. In this installment, we explore the journey of Ava, a powerhouse executive in commercial construction. Ava was overseeing a massive high-rise project when her physical body began failing her completely. She suffered from debilitating sciatica and incredibly poor stress management, leaving her bedridden most days. Unable to be on-site to lead her crews, the project faced massive delays, racking up five million dollars in penalty fees. Ava was trying to manage a multi-million dollar high-rise from a horizontal position. Instead of fixing timelines, we fixed her physical scaffolding by decompressing her spine and rebuilding her core.
First, we engaged in biomechanical decompression to address the intense mechanical pressure on her sciatic nerve. We used a daily inversion table routine, employing gravity to pull the vertebrae apart, relieving nerve impingement and allowing blood back into the discs. We paired this inversion therapy with targeted Pilates to strengthen her deep stabilizing core and pelvic floor. Next, we changed her raw materials through a high-protein diet and strict deep cellular hydration protocols. Spinal discs have a center called the nucleus pulposus made almost entirely of water. Chronic dehydration makes these discs flatten and bulge outward, pinching nerves. Deep systemic hydration plumped her discs back up to restore shock-absorbing capability. The high-protein diet provided the amino acids needed to quickly build stabilizing muscle mass.
We also implemented a clinical supplement program to aggressively calm nerve pain and support rehabilitation. We started with Alpha Lipoic Acid, an antioxidant that crosses the blood-brain barrier to reduce oxidative stress and soothe peripheral neuropathy. Second, we used Benfotiamine, a highly bioavailable, fat-soluble form of Vitamin B1. Nerves have a protective myelin sheath, and Benfotiamine provided the exact metabolic fuel to repair this sheath and restore normal signaling. Third, we added PEA, a naturally occurring fatty acid amide that interacts with the endocannabinoid system to naturally turn down pain signals. Fourth, we prescribed Whey Protein Isolate to deliver a leucine spike, triggering muscle protein synthesis for Pilates recovery. Finally, we incorporated Magnesium Malate, a combination of magnesium and malic acid, to stop protective muscle spasms and boost cellular energy production.
The transformation was absolute. Ava's sciatica completely disappeared, and she returned to the job site stronger, more resilient, and energized. Free from physical pain, her stress management improved, and her leadership galvanized her crews. They finished the high-rise ahead of the revised schedule, entirely erasing the previous deficit and earning her firm a massive twelve million dollar early completion bonus. Ava's story proves you cannot build towering success on a collapsing foundation. Fix your physical structure first, and the rest will stand tall.
